From 349332bd896d4ba249f66152bf6634d1f22be636 Mon Sep 17 00:00:00 2001 From: Wojciech Kozlowski Date: Sun, 8 Sep 2024 23:20:19 +0200 Subject: [PATCH] Move test --- src/tui/app/machine/browse.rs | 7 ------- src/tui/app/machine/fetch.rs | 8 +++++++- 2 files changed, 7 insertions(+), 8 deletions(-) diff --git a/src/tui/app/machine/browse.rs b/src/tui/app/machine/browse.rs index e8ea66a..fe6014a 100644 --- a/src/tui/app/machine/browse.rs +++ b/src/tui/app/machine/browse.rs @@ -166,13 +166,6 @@ mod tests { app.unwrap_search(); } - #[test] - fn fetch_musicbrainz_no_artist() { - let browse = AppMachine::browse(inner(music_hoard(vec![]))); - let app = browse.fetch_musicbrainz(); - app.unwrap_error(); - } - #[test] fn fetch_musicbrainz() { let mb_api = MockIMusicBrainz::new(); diff --git a/src/tui/app/machine/fetch.rs b/src/tui/app/machine/fetch.rs index b0e3c4e..da924bd 100644 --- a/src/tui/app/machine/fetch.rs +++ b/src/tui/app/machine/fetch.rs @@ -199,7 +199,7 @@ mod tests { use crate::tui::{ app::{ machine::tests::{inner, music_hoard}, - AppAlbumMatches, AppArtistMatches, + AppAlbumMatches, AppArtistMatches, IAppInteract, }, event::EventReceiver, lib::interface::musicbrainz::{self, Match, MockIMusicBrainz}, @@ -209,6 +209,12 @@ mod tests { use super::*; + #[test] + fn fetch_no_artist() { + let app = AppMachine::app_fetch_new(inner(music_hoard(vec![]))); + assert!(matches!(app.state(), AppState::Error(_))); + } + fn event_channel() -> (EventSender, EventReceiver) { let event_channel = EventChannel::new(); let events_tx = event_channel.sender();